Transaction e7155266f63f62d1bfe57ea9876f10e7d2da226dac97abdc8ae81cf124f0581d

1 Input
2 Outputs
  • e7155266f63f62d1bfe57ea9876f10e7d2da226dac97abdc8ae81cf124f0581d:0
  • value  13800000
    address  35kW1Q8nVbvFhSNatN6TCS1rWoA5TdZYS5
  • e7155266f63f62d1bfe57ea9876f10e7d2da226dac97abdc8ae81cf124f0581d:1
  • value  904842
    address  3PgukqJLZHmZ8DYbwLDymhRor18tZydJM1